Pennsylvania Buries Graffiti Highway
After 58 years on fire, it's taken a global pandemic and a stay-at-home order to put an end to the ghost town-turned-tourist-attraction in Centralia, Pa. The site of an uncontrolled, underground coal fire since 1962, this strip of Route 61 known as Graffiti Highway has been covered with dirt by workers with heavy equipment and shut down after visitors swarmed the site during the coronavirus lockdown....
